Super tasty. Dark fruit with bittering hoppy pine flavor over a full and malty base. Exceptionally smooth for the ABV. Super drinkable, great beer.

This one's growing on me. Initially, more hoppy on the nose and palate than I expected, even for an American style. As it warms, more of the sweet caramel and fruity notes are present. It's still pleasantly bitter, with a lingering herbal hop presence.
